A Rare Dinner Experience With “Iron Chef Sakai”

Posted by: TP Newswire    Tags:  American Airlines, Chef Sakai, Hiroyuki Sakai, InterContinental LA Century, Iron Chef Sakai, Iron Chef Sakai LIVE, JASSC, Nitto Tire U.S.A, Sumitomo Realty, Sumitomo Realty & Development, Tomoshige Mizutani    Posted date:  December 13, 2012  |  No comment



Los Angeles, U.S.A. — Local celebrities and more than 220 members and supporters of the Japan America Society of Southern California (JASSC) enjoyed a rare dinner experience Saturday night at its Iron Chef Sakai LIVE event, featuring a multi-course gourmet meal prepared by Japan’s most famous chef, Hiroyuki Sakai, better known as “Iron Chef Sakai”.

The dinner took place at the InterContinental LA Century City at Beverly Hills and it was co-presented by Nitto Tire U.S.A. and the InterContinental LA Century City at Beverly Hills. American Airlines served as the event’s official airline sponsor. Proceeds will benefit the JASSC, an organization established to build meaningful relationships between Japanese and Americans.

Iron Chef is a popular television cooking show produced in Japan by Fuji Television Network “Iron Chef Sakai LIVE” was Fuji Television’s first-ever official Iron Chef event outside of Japan. As each of the six courses were prepared, large screens aired live video of Iron Chef Sakai in the kitchen. Chef Sakai, working side-by-side with the InterContinental LA luxury hotel’s executive chef, Jonathan Wood, also greeted guests and introduced each course. At the conclusion of the dinner, chefs Sakai and Wood posed for photographs with the guests.

Chef Sakai was clearly delighted. “It is a great honor for me to come to Los Angeles and work with Executive Chef Jonathan Wood on this special dinner event,” said Chef Sakai. “It was a lot of work, but the results speak for themselves.”

“In my twenty years at Japan America Society, this was one of our most enjoyable and memorable events,” said JASSC president, Douglas Erber. “It was a once-in-a-lifetime dinner experience for everyone involved, and it introduced a groundbreaking form of ‘dinner show’ entertainment with the guests and chefs interacting with one another through live audio and video.”

“For helping make tonight possible, we have to thank my good friend and mentor, Mitsuhiro Furusawa, a director-general in Japan’s Ministry of Finance,” said Tomoshige Mizutani, president of Nitto Tire U.S.A. “Mr. Furusawa was involved in the 2000 G-7 Finance Ministers’ Summit hosted in Japan where Chef Sakai prepared the meals for the finance ministers and central bank directors.” Mizutani added that Mr. Furusawa persuaded Chef Sakai to visit Los Angeles for the Iron Chef Sakai LIVE event.

Mizutani’s motivation for supporting Iron Chef Sakai LIVE was both to help promote JASSC and to express appreciation for the unprecedented support from America after last year’s devastating earthquake and tsunami in Japan. Nitto Tire U.S.A. has a manufacturing plant in the Sendai area, where its workers and the plant were affected by the disaster.

“Working with Iron Chef Sakai was truly a special experience,” said Mari Miyoshi, president of Sumitomo Realty & Development, U.S.A., owner of the InterContinental LA Century City at Beverly Hills. “Chef Sakai is very humble, and although we just met for the first time, Executive Chef Jonathan Wood and our hotel staff quickly developed an immediate connection and we felt as if we have been working with him for years.”

“American Airlines was honored to be a part of this amazing evening,” said Nancy Matsui, national sales director at American Airlines.  “We welcome Chef Sakai’s return to the city of Los Angeles anytime.”

It was clear from the enthusiastic reactions from the evening’s dinner guests that they, too, will welcome Chef Sakai back to Los Angeles.
